Output d3e4dbde32580127c70ba8195ab1ac696b188f80c4458a88748eb01966be274b:0

value
1429120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 978395e05524604bec23bf1e57f14b665a477e40 OP_EQUAL
address
MMiHu7aWyFiLuvctNQr1ZStCp3sydfQmTs
transaction
d3e4dbde32580127c70ba8195ab1ac696b188f80c4458a88748eb01966be274b
spent
true